Overview of Quick Charge 5+
Qualcomm’s Quick Charge technology has been a significant player in the fast-charging landscape since its inception. The company has now introduced Quick Charge 5+, an upgrade that aims to improve the charging experience for users while maintaining compatibility with older devices. This announcement comes just ahead of Qualcomm’s annual Snapdragon technology summit, where the company typically showcases its latest innovations.
Key Features of Quick Charge 5+
Quick Charge 5+ builds upon the foundation laid by its predecessor, Quick Charge 5, which was released in 2020. The new iteration focuses on two main aspects: temperature management and backward compatibility. Here are the key features of Quick Charge 5+:
- Enhanced Cooling Technology: One of the standout features of Quick Charge 5+ is its improved thermal management system. The technology is designed to keep devices cooler during the charging process, which can help prolong battery life and improve overall device performance.
- Backward Compatibility: Quick Charge 5+ is designed to work seamlessly with devices that support earlier versions of Quick Charge. This means that users can upgrade their charging accessories without needing to replace their existing devices.
- Faster Charging Speeds: While Quick Charge 5 already offered impressive charging speeds, Quick Charge 5+ aims to push those limits even further, allowing users to charge their devices more quickly than ever before.
- Smart Power Management: The new technology incorporates advanced algorithms to optimize power delivery based on the device’s needs, ensuring that charging is both efficient and safe.

Impact on Battery Life
One of the primary concerns with fast charging technologies has been their impact on battery health. Rapid charging can generate significant heat, which can degrade battery performance over time. With Quick Charge 5+, Qualcomm’s enhanced cooling technology aims to mitigate these issues, potentially extending the lifespan of smartphone batteries. By keeping temperatures in check, users may find that their devices maintain optimal performance for a longer period.

Technical Specifications
Understanding the technical specifications of Quick Charge 5+ can provide further insight into its capabilities. Qualcomm has designed this technology to handle power levels up to 100W, making it suitable for a wide range of devices, from smartphones to laptops. The charging standard supports multiple voltage levels, allowing for flexible power delivery based on the device’s requirements.
Power Delivery and Efficiency
Quick Charge 5+ utilizes a combination of voltage and current to deliver power efficiently. The technology can dynamically adjust the voltage and current to optimize charging speeds while minimizing heat generation. This adaptability is crucial for maintaining battery health and ensuring that devices charge quickly without compromising safety.
Safety Features
Safety is a paramount concern in charging technologies, and Quick Charge 5+ incorporates several safety features to protect both the device and the user. These include:
- Overvoltage Protection: Prevents excessive voltage from damaging the device.
- Overcurrent Protection: Safeguards against excessive current that could lead to overheating.
- Thermal Protection: Monitors temperature levels to ensure safe charging conditions.
